Ankle Replacement

Total ankle replacement (arthroplasty) replaces a damaged ankle joint with metal and plastic components, preserving natural ankle motion unlike ankle fusion. Modern implants last 10-15+ years and are ideal for patients with severe ankle arthritis who want to maintain mobility.

Implant lifespan: 10-15+ years | Recovery: 3-6 months | Preserves motion: Yes

Achilles Repair

Achilles tendon repair surgery reconnects a torn Achilles tendon — the largest and strongest tendon in the body. Both open and minimally invasive (percutaneous) techniques are available. Early repair gives the best outcomes, with most patients returning to full activity in 6-12 months.

Success rate: 90-95% | Return to activity: 6-12 months | Technique: Open or percutaneous

Plantar Fasciitis Treatment

Plantar fasciitis treatment addresses inflammation of the thick band of tissue running across the bottom of the foot. Most cases resolve with conservative care — stretching, orthotics, physical therapy, and injections. Surgery (plantar fascia release) is reserved for cases that fail 6-12 months of non-surgical treatment.

Conservative success: 90%+ | Surgery recovery: 6-10 weeks | Common age: 40-60

What is a Orthopedic Surgeon?
Orthopedic Surgeons undergo rigorous training including 4 years of medical school followed by a 5-year orthopedic surgery residency. Many pursue additional fellowship training in foot and ankle surgery. They treat complex fractures, ligament injuries, arthritis, and deformities of the foot and ankle.
